UFC sponsors University of Iowa wrestling programs

December 15, 2022 by Jason Cruz Leave a Comment

The University of Iowa Athletics Department and multimedia rightsholder LEARFIELD’s Hawkeye Sports Properties announced that the UFC will serve as a sponsor of the men’s and women’s wrestling programs. It is the first time that the UFC has sponsored a college sports program. The sponsorship encompasses signage inside Carver-Hawkeye Arena, as well as exposure during […]

UFC Fight Night Orlando draws 1.014M viewers Saturday

December 6, 2022 by Jason Cruz Leave a Comment

UFC Fight Night 42 took place on Saturday night at the Amway Center in Orlando, Florida.  The event drew 1.014M viewers on ESPN and was first overall in cable viewing.  The prelims were 3rd overall and drew 877,000 viewers. The telecast for the main card aired later than most on the network with a 10pm […]

Ontario bans bets on UFC fights

December 1, 2022 by Jason Cruz Leave a Comment

The Alcohol and Gaming Commission of Ontario will no longer take bets on the Ultimate Fighting Championships “due to concerns about non-compliance with AGCO’s betting integrity requirements” according to a news release.  A portion of the news release reads: The Registrar’s Standards include rules to safeguard against odds manipulation, match-fixing and other sports betting integrity […]
